Where Was Curtis Sliwa Born? Unveiling the Birthplace of the Guardian Angels Founder

Curtis Sliwa was born in the Bronx, a borough of New York City, and his early life in New York shaped his path toward community activism.

Below is a concise profile overview that captures key facts about his birthplace and background, followed by deeper sections focused on his origins and career.

Full Name Curtis Sliwa
Birthplace The Bronx, New York City, New York, United States
Date of Birth March 15, 1954
Known For Founder of the Guardian Angels, radio talk host, political candidate
